What should a supervisor do regarding loss prevention strategies?

Implementing training programs and awareness campaigns among employees is essential for effective loss prevention strategies. Supervisors play a key role in fostering a culture of vigilance where all staff members are educated on the importance of loss prevention and are equipped with the knowledge and tools to identify and report suspicious activities. By actively involving employees in loss prevention efforts, the workplace becomes more secure, as team members are more likely to notice irregularities and act accordingly. This collaborative approach not only enhances security but also promotes accountability and teamwork among staff members.

Additionally, training programs can include tips on recognizing potential theft behaviors and strategies for customer service that can deter shoplifting. This proactive measure not only helps to protect the store's assets but also builds employee confidence and involvement in the overall success of the business.

Other strategies mentioned, such as increasing surveillance without informing employees or reducing staff responsibilities in loss prevention, could create distrust or disengagement, while a customer complaint hotline does not directly address the prevention of loss. Therefore, establishing comprehensive training and awareness initiatives aligns best with successful loss prevention practices.
